Appeal of media NGOs to Ukraine's presidential candidates regarding the debates

We, representatives of Ukrainian media organizations, are deeply concerned about the situation around the debates between presidential candidates before the second round of Ukrainian presidential elections.

It is impossible to prohibit the meaningless election campaign at the legislative level. But this should not be used customarily by politicians, who are responsible for the country’s development. And given the real security, geopolitical and socio-economic challenges facing Ukraine, such actions cause enormous harm to the whole society.

Therefore, we urge both candidates to take part in TV debates in the studio of the National Public Broadcasting Company of Ukraine. It is exactly this kind of debates financed by the state budget is envisaged by Article 62 of the Law “On Elections of the President of Ukraine”. We welcome the show at the Olimpiyskiy Stadium as one of the possible forms of political agitation. However, it cannot replace the official debates with clearly defined rules.

This will be the last chance for the candidates to outline the plans for the future and provide a meaningful presentation of their own vision of the country's development. Any arguments for refusing to participate in official debates will be considered unacceptable for a democratic country.
